Jeremy Corbyn

Jeremy Corbyn is a Member of Parliament in Britain for Islington North. He was the leader of the U.K.’s Labour Party from 2015 to 2020 before being forced out by the party’s right-wing and neoliberal faction. For decades, he has been a dedicated leader of the peace movement in Britain.


LATEST ARTICLES BY Jeremy Corbyn